STILLMAN VALLEY – In a 34-7 win over Oregon, it looked like Stillman Valley’s offense operated in fourth gear while the Hawks were stuck in third.
“This was among one of the quickest Stillman teams I’ve seen,” Oregon coach John Bothe said. “It was hard for us to adjust to it.”
Not only were running backs Matt Stone and Brit Vernon especially difficult for Oregon to corral, but their elusiveness set up 220-pound fullback Zac Hare to operate between the tackles.
